
India head coach Gautam Gambhir took to social media to dedicate the country’s historic third T20 World Cup title to the millions of fans whose unwavering support fueled the team’s journey to glory.

Gambhir wrote on X (formerly Twitter): “It wasn’t just God’s plan, it was the plan of 1.4 billion Indians! Every player is a WORLD CHAMPION!” — a passionate tribute that captured the euphoria of an entire nation united behind its cricket team.

India made history books by becoming the first team to successfully defend the T20 World Cup title and the first team to win the tournament on home soil. In a dominant final at the Narendra Modi Stadium, India crushed New Zealand by 96 runs to lift their third T20 World Cup trophy, sending fans across the country into frenzied celebration.
Talk to post-match press conference, Gambhir took a moment to take credit for the architects behind India’s sustained success — the men who built the system long before the trophies arrived.
He reserved special praise for former head coach Rahul Dravid, crediting him for maintaining the structure and stability of the team during his tenure – the foundation Gambhir built on to achieve championship results.
Gambhir also shed light on VVS Laxman, who heads BCCI’s center of excellence, and praised his often unseen but vital contributions in identifying and nurturing the next generation of Indian cricketing talent through the national pipeline.
Chief selector Ajit Agarkar also got a hearty mention. Acknowledging the criticism Agarkar often faces, Gambhir praised his honesty and unwavering commitment to the role.
Perhaps the most personal honor, however, was reserved for ICC Chairman Jay Shah. Gambhir revealed that Shah was the only voice of support during the darkest periods of his coaching tenure, after the back-to-back series losses to New Zealand and South Africa.
“Not many people actually called me when I was going through the worst moments of my tenure. The only one who really called me was Jay Bhai,” Gambhir said, underscoring the importance of loyalty and faith when results don’t go your way.
It was a team effort in every sense – on and off the pitch.
